The Evolution of Game Development in the Casino Sector

Historically, casino game development followed a relatively predictable path. New games were often based on existing popular titles, with minor tweaks or cosmetic changes to differentiate them. The development cycle was long and expensive, with a significant risk of launching a game that didn't resonate with players. This traditional model often prioritized minimizing risk over pursuing truly innovative ideas. However, the digital revolution has fundamentally altered the dynamic, enabling rapid prototyping and direct player feedback. The creation of a 'testing ground' – what we now associate with the concept of a modern lab casino – allows for a more agile and responsive development process. This modern approach acknowledges that understanding player preferences is crucial, and that continuous refinement is vital for success.

The rise of data analytics plays a pivotal role in this evolution. Sophisticated tools now allow operators to track player behavior in minute detail, identifying patterns, preferences, and pain points. This data-driven approach enables designers to optimize game mechanics, adjust difficulty levels, and personalize the gaming experience to a degree that was previously unimaginable. Furthermore, the proliferation of online casinos has created a vast pool of potential testers, making it easier and more cost-effective to gather feedback on new game concepts. The ability to A/B test different game variations in real-time provides invaluable insights, accelerating the development process and increasing the likelihood of a successful launch.

The Role of Player Feedback and Iteration

Central to the success of any lab casino is the commitment to actively soliciting and incorporating player feedback. This isn't simply about asking players what they think of a game; it's about observing their actual behavior and using that data to inform design decisions. Tools like heatmaps, session recordings, and eye-tracking technology provide a granular understanding of how players interact with a game, revealing areas of confusion, frustration, or engagement. This type of data allows developers to identify and address issues that might not be apparent through traditional playtesting. The iterative process, fueled by continuous feedback, is what ultimately separates successful game concepts from those that fail to gain traction.

Effective feedback mechanisms are key. Developers need to create channels for players to easily report bugs, suggest improvements, and share their overall impressions. This could involve in-game surveys, dedicated forums, or social media engagement. Crucially, it's essential to respond to player feedback in a timely and transparent manner, demonstrating that their opinions are valued. This fosters a sense of community and encourages players to continue participating in the development process. Building a loyal player base through collaborative design is a significant advantage in the competitive casino gaming market.

Technology Driving the Lab Casino Experience

The advancements powering the concept of a lab casino are diverse and rapidly evolving. Virtual Reality (VR) and Augmented Reality (AR) are perhaps the most visible examples, offering the potential to create truly immersive gaming experiences that blur the lines between the physical and digital worlds. Imagine stepping into a virtual casino environment, interacting with other players, and experiencing the thrill of the game as if you were actually there. However, the technological foundation extends far beyond just VR/AR. Sophisticated game engines, advanced graphics rendering techniques, and high-speed internet connectivity are all essential components. The integration of cloud computing allows for scalable infrastructure and the ability to handle a large number of concurrent players without performance issues.

Furthermore, the emergence of blockchain technology is having a profound impact on the casino industry. Blockchain-based games offer increased transparency, provably fair outcomes, and the potential for decentralized gaming platforms. This addresses some of the key concerns that players have about the fairness and security of online casinos. Smart contracts can automate payouts and ensure that all transactions are recorded on an immutable ledger, eliminating the possibility of manipulation. The use of cryptocurrencies also allows for faster and more secure transactions, reducing the need for traditional banking intermediaries. This technological foundation is leading to a new era of trust and transparency in online gaming.

Regulatory Considerations and Responsible Gaming

The rise of the lab casino concept also brings with it a set of important regulatory considerations. As these platforms experiment with new game mechanics and technologies, it’s crucial to ensure that they comply with all applicable laws and regulations regarding gambling. This includes licensing requirements, age verification procedures, and measures to prevent money laundering. Operators must work closely with regulatory bodies to demonstrate that their games are fair, transparent, and do not exploit vulnerable players. The evolving landscape of online gaming requires a proactive and collaborative approach to regulation, balancing innovation with consumer protection.

Responsible gaming is another paramount concern. The lab casino environment, with its emphasis on experimentation and engagement, could potentially increase the risk of problem gambling. Operators have a responsibility to implement measures to protect players from harm, such as setting deposit limits, offering self-exclusion options, and providing access to resources for problem gamblers. Data analytics can also be used to identify players who may be at risk and proactively offer them support. A commitment to responsible gaming is not only ethically sound but also essential for maintaining the long-term sustainability of the industry. Developing robust responsible gaming frameworks and educating players about the risks of gambling are integral components of a successful lab casino operation.
